How Does Coinbase Impact Altcoin Prices?

Recent activities in the cryptocurrency market have shown the significant influence of listings and delistings by major exchanges. Notably, Binance‘s addition of Toncoin (TON) caused its price to spike by over 40% in mere minutes. Shortly after, Coinbase made a notable announcement, drawing attention to three altcoins with the initiation of futures trading.

What Altcoins Did Coinbase List?

Coinbase, a major global exchange, has a well-documented impact on market prices through its listings. Recently, it announced the introduction of perpetual futures trading for three altcoins: Degen (DEGEN), EOS, and SATS. The new trading pairs, DEGEN-PERP, EOS-PERP, and 1000STATS-PERP, will be available starting August 15, 2024, at 9:30 UTC.

How Did Prices React?

Following Coinbase’s announcement, the market keenly observed the price movements of these altcoins. DEGEN experienced a notable surge, increasing by over 30% to reach $0.004154, which elevated its market cap to $58 million. Meanwhile, 1000SATS saw a 15% rise to $0.0002528, with its market cap surpassing $530 million, despite a 13.5% drop in trading volume. EOS recorded a modest 7% increase, trading at $0.479.
